Fiber Optic Patch Cable|Fiber Optic Patchcord MPO-LC/UPC Female 8 Cores Type B Multimode OM4 Corning Low Loss 0.35dB Max 3.0mm OFNP Plenum 1m (3ft)
Specifications
This LC to MPO fiber optic patchcord features 8-core OM4 multimode fiber, delivering high-speed data transmission for up to 40G networks. Designed with a female MPO connector and four LC/UPC duplex fanouts, it enables efficient breakout from backbone trunk systems to endpoint devices. With low insertion loss 0.35dB Max, it ensures excellent signal quality even in high-density applications. The 3.0mm OFNP-rated plenum jacket offers flame retardance and is certified for use in air-handling spaces such as ceilings and ventilation ducts. Type B polarity ensures proper channel alignment for parallel optics, making this patchcord ideal for modern data centers, enterprise networks, and telecom infrastructure requiring superior performance and fire-safe compliance.

Yes, you can use cable ties to secure the patchcord. However, be careful not to overtighten the cable ties, as this can put excessive pressure on the cable and potentially damage the fibers. Use cable ties that are designed for use with fiber optic cables and apply them with just enough tension to hold the cable in place.
In a data center, this patchcord is commonly used for top - of - rack (ToR) switch to server connections in high - speed Ethernet networks. It can also be used for connecting storage area network (SAN) devices, such as Fibre Channel switches to storage arrays, where high - density fiber optic connections are required.?
This type of patchcord is generally designed for indoor use. Outdoor installations require cables that are specifically designed to withstand environmental factors such as UV radiation, moisture, and temperature variations. Using an indoor - only patchcord outdoors will likely result in premature failure due to damage from these environmental elements.?
For short - distance 5G fronthaul or backhaul applications within a building or a campus, where multimode fiber can be used, this patchcord may be suitable. However, for long - distance 5G backhaul, which typically requires single - mode fiber for its ability to transmit over longer distances with less loss, this multimode patchcord would not be appropriate.?
Standard MPO - LC OM4 fanout patchcords are not ideal for harsh industrial environments. Industrial settings often have high levels of vibration, dust, and temperature fluctuations. In such environments, you should use ruggedized fiber optic cables that are designed to withstand these conditions and offer better protection for the fibers.?
